Watch the closing keynote from GopherCon 2015 delivered by Andrew Gerrand, a prominent figure in the Go programming language community. Gain valuable insights into the state of Go, its ecosystem, and future directions as Gerrand shares his thoughts and reflections on the language's progress and potential. Explore key takeaways from the conference and discover how Go continues to evolve and impact the world of software development. This 32-minute talk offers a unique opportunity to hear from one of Go's influential voices and stay up-to-date with the latest developments in the Go community.
